Fertilization occurs when a sperm cell from a male merges with an egg cell from a female, typically within the female's reproductive tract. This process usually involves the sperm traveling through the female's reproductive system to reach the egg, which is released during ovulation. Upon successful penetration of the egg's outer layer by a sperm, their genetic materials combine to form a zygote, initiating the development of a new organism. Fertilization can occur through sexual intercourse or assisted reproductive technologies, such as in vitro fertilization.

In most amphibians, fertilization takes place externally instead of internally. To prevent the eggs from drying out, external fertilization occurs in water or another moist place.

In bryophytes, fertilization typically takes place in the archegonium, which is the female reproductive structure. The sperm swims through water to reach the egg inside the archegonium, where fertilization occurs.
